An energy-stable Smoothed Particle Hydrodynamics discretization of the Navier-Stokes-Cahn-Hilliard model for incompressible two-phase flows

Varieties of energy-stable numerical methods have been developed for incompressible two-phase flows based on the Navier-Stokes–Cahn–Hilliard (NSCH) model in Eulerian framework, while few investigations made Lagrangian framework. Smoothed particle hydrodynamics (SPH) is a popular mesh-free method solving complex fluid flows. In this paper, we present pioneering study SPH discretization NSCH We prove that inherits mass and momentum conservation energy dissipation properties at fully discrete level. With projection procedure to decouple continuity equations, scheme meets divergence-free condition. Some experiments are carried out show performance proposed model. The inheritance verified numerically.
